# apple-ocsp-noiser
Privacy-Preserving Noise Machine for Apple Developer ID OCSP> Read [the writeup](https://kiding.medium.com/macos-ocsp-telemetry-explainer-and-mitigation-9bc243928f4c) for the full details.
macOS sends a periodic OCSP request *in plaintext* with a **serial number** of the developer certificate of the app that's being installed or launched. Whether the intention, the requests themselves can be used as *telemetry* by anyone on the network; ISPs, governments, etc.
Blocking `ocsp.apple.com` entirely will hinder Apple's built-in malware protection. What we should do instead is to *confuse* the eavesdroppers in the middle by adding noise.
`apple-ocsp-noiser` sends out an OCSP request to `http://ocsp.apple.com` with a *random* legitimate or nonexistent **serial number** for every *random* period of time.
Download `script.sh`, examine the file, then run it with `zsh`.
```bash
cd /Users/Shared/ || exit 1
curl -Ro 'apple-ocsp-noiser.sh' --fail -- \
'https://raw.githubusercontent.com/kiding/apple-ocsp-noiser/main/script.sh'
chmod +x apple-ocsp-noiser.sh# If you're confident the script is trustworthy:
/bin/zsh apple-ocsp-noiser.sh
```You can also install the script to run at load:

```## Serial Number Submission
A well-equipped eavesdropper might have a database of *Developer ID* serial numbers. You can help the project by adding more legitimate serial numbers in the *random* pool. Make an issue or a pull request with **only** the serial numbers in hex format.
Please **do not post** the name of apps or developers. Creating a trackable database is not the purpose here.
